How much does a Infection Preventionist make?
A career as an Infection Preventionist can be both fulfilling and financially rewarding. The average yearly salary for Infection Preventionists stands at $93,392. This position requires a mix of medical knowledge and organizational skills to help prevent the spread of infections in healthcare settings. Skilled Infection Preventionists play a key role in maintaining the safety and health of both patients and staff.
Salary can vary based on experience, location, and the type of healthcare facility. For instance, those with a few years of experience might earn around $67,345, while those with more experience can earn over $143,000 annually. This variance shows that as one gains more experience and expertise, the potential for higher earnings increases. Infection Preventionists in larger cities or specialized hospitals often see higher salaries compared to those in smaller towns or general settings.

How to earn more as a Infection Preventionist?
Infection preventionists play a crucial role in keeping people safe from infections. They work in hospitals, clinics, and other health care settings. If you want to earn more in this field, consider these key factors. Doing so can boost your salary and career growth.
First, gaining advanced certifications can lead to higher pay. Many employers value specialized skills. Certifications like Certified Infection Control (CIC) can open up more job opportunities. This credential shows a strong understanding of infection control practices.
- Advanced Certifications: Get specialized credentials to stand out.
- Experience: More years of experience can lead to higher salaries.
- Geographic Location: Working in high-demand areas may offer better pay.
- Specialization: Focus on areas like surgical site infections or antibiotic resistance.
- Continuous Education: Keep learning to stay updated and increase value.
Experience also matters greatly. The more time you spend in the field, the more knowledge you gain. This experience can help you take on more responsibilities and earn a higher salary. Specializing in certain areas of infection prevention can also make you more valuable. For example, focusing on antibiotic resistance or surgical site infections can set you apart from others.
